Electron-volts to joules

The electronvolt is a unit of energy used in physics, most commonly in electrostatic particle accelerator sciences.

Electronvolts can be abbreviated as eV; for example, 1 electronvolt can be written as 1 eV.

Energy in electronvolts can be expressed using the following formula: E = qV

The energy E in electronvolts is equal to the electric charge q in elementary charge times the potential difference V in volts.

The joule is the energy equal to the force on an object of one newton at a distance of one meter. One joule is equal to the heat energy dissipated by the current of one ampere through one ohm of resistance for one second.

One joule is also equal to the energy needed to move an electric charge of one coulomb through a potential difference of one volt. In addition, one joule is also equal to the one watt-second. The joule is the SI derived unit for energy in the metric system. Joules can be abbreviated as J; for example, 1 joule can be written as 1 J.

How to convert eV to joules

One electron-volt is equal to 1.602176565⋅10-19 joules:

1eV = 1.602176565e-19 J = 1.602176565⋅10-19 J

So the energy in joules E(J) is equal to the energy in electron-volts E(eV) times 1.602176565⋅10-19:

E(J) = E(eV) × 1.602176565⋅10-19
